1990 MATHEMATICA CONFERENCE
January 11-13, 1990
Redwood City, California


PURPOSE

The 1990 Mathematica Conference is intended for those interested in Mathematica
and its applications.  It will include invited and contributed talks and
demonstrations, tutorials, exhibits, and other activities.

LECTURES

Steve Christensen (NCSA): 
Gravity Theory

Dorian Goldfeld (Columbia): 
Number Theory

Sam Savage (University of Chicago): 
Calculus in Business

Dana Scott (Carnegie-Mellon): 
Teaching Projective Geometry

Terry Sejnowski (Salk Institute): 
Neural Networks

Steve Skiena (SUNY, Stony Brook): 
Combinatorics and Graph Theory

Jerry Uhl (University of Illinois): 
Mathematica Courseware: Calculus

Andrew B. Watson (NASA Ames):
Vision Science

Rob Wolff (Apple): 
Interactive Visualization and Distributed Computing

Stephen Wolfram (WRI): 
Future Directions in Computing
